↑ 1.41pp vs 2011Year-over-Year Comparison
| Indicator | 2011 | 2012 | Change |
|---|---|---|---|
| GDP (Current USD) | $1.57 billion | $1.60 billion | +1.90% |
| GDP per Capita | $9,128.99 | $9,260.30 | +1.44% |
| GDP Growth (Annual %) | 4.33% | -0.11% | -4.44pp |
| Inflation (CPI %) | 2.77% | 4.18% | +1.41pp |
| Unemployment Rate (%) | 18.86% | 19.06% | +0.20pp |
